首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

检测浏览器自动播放功能的API

AutoplayPolicy API。

AutoplayPolicy API是一个用于检测浏览器自动播放功能的接口,它可以帮助开发者判断浏览器是否允许自动播放音视频内容。该API可以返回一个字符串,表示浏览器对自动播放功能的策略。

AutoplayPolicy API主要有以下几个分类:

  1. user-gesture-required:表示浏览器要求用户手势触发才能自动播放音视频内容。在这种策略下,开发者需要在用户触发了某个事件(例如点击、滚动等)后才能进行自动播放。
  2. document-user-activation-required:表示浏览器要求文档中的某个元素(例如按钮)被用户激活后才能自动播放音视频内容。在这种策略下,开发者需要确保用户在页面上进行了某些操作后才能进行自动播放。
  3. no-user-gesture-required:表示浏览器允许自动播放音视频内容,无需用户手势触发或激活。在这种策略下,开发者可以直接进行自动播放。

根据不同的策略,开发者可以选择不同的解决方案来满足浏览器的要求。以下是一些应用场景和推荐的腾讯云相关产品:

  1. 应用场景:
    • 在网站或应用中自动播放背景音乐或视频。
    • 在广告或营销页面中自动播放宣传视频。
    • 在教育平台中自动播放教学视频。
  • 腾讯云相关产品:

通过使用腾讯云的相关产品,开发者可以轻松实现自动播放功能,并提供稳定高效的音视频处理和传输能力,为用户提供良好的体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

解决浏览器中不支持音频自动播放方法

/api/#provide-inject 所以我们这边把壁咚声安排一下吧, 在App.vue中祭出如下短小精悍代码 provide: { audio: new Audio(require('...在组件中,它接收一个混入对象数组,Mixin 钩子按照传入顺序依次调用,并在调用组件自身钩子之前被调用, 具体参见:https://cn.vuejs.org/v2/api/#mixins 所以我们可以创建一个...大致意思是需要引导用户去交互,也就是要引导用户先去触发一次交互。通过查询相关资料,Chrome在2018年4月份发布66版本关掉了声音自动播放,哦,原来是这样子啊。...不行,阿Sir说了,一定得壁咚一下 这里我想到一个做法是,先去检测用户浏览器是否支持自动播放,如果不支持的话,我弹出一个框,让用户点一下,那么下次就有壁咚声了,233333333。...$alert( '检测到您浏览器不支持媒体自动播放,是否同意播放测试音', '提示', { confirmButtonText

4.8K20

解决苹果Safari 浏览器下html不能自动播放声音和视频问题-实时语音通话功能【唯一客服】

在实现我客服系统中,实时语音通话功能时候,如果想自动播放音视频流,在苹果设备上遇到了问题。 苹果浏览器(Safari)在默认情况下不允许声音在背景里自动播放。...这是出于用户体验和隐私方面的考虑,避免在用户没有意识到情况下自动播放声音。 解决办法是 iOS 11 及以上版本 Safari 浏览器。...然后动态js设置一下,就能自动播放声音了 然后在js里动态设置一下属性...myAudio.autoplay = true; // 将 autoplay 属性设置为 true myAudio.play(); // 播放音频 这样 在页面至少有过交互以后,可以让苹果设备上自动播放声音了

3.4K80
  • Android使用自定义属性实现图片自动播放滚动功能

    大家好,记得上次我带着大家一起实现了一个类似与淘宝客户端中带有的图片滚动播放器效果,但是在做完了之后,发现忘了加入图片自动播放功能(或许是我有意忘记加…..),结果图片只能通过手指滑动来播放。...这次程序开发将完全基于上一次代码,如果有朋友还未看过上篇文章,请先阅读Android实现图片滚动和页签控件功能实现代码。 既然是要加入自动播放功能,那么就有一个非常重要问题需要考虑。...之后只要在Activity创建时候去调用SlidingSwitcherViewstartAutoPlay方法,自动播放功能就实现了!! 结束了?Naive!!...接下来才是今天重点,我们要使用自定义属性来启用自动播放功能,这样才能让你更加接近高手,才能让你更加玩转Android。...,如果为true,就调用startAutoPlay方法,从而启用了自动播放功能

    1.5K10

    APISpace 人脸检测API 它来啦~

    人脸检测是指通过计算机视觉技术,从图像中识别、检测出人脸,并确定人脸位置及大小。它是一种计算机图像处理技术,是计算机视觉领域关键技术,可用于实现自动识别和跟踪人脸。...近几年来,随着深度学习发展,人脸检测API已成为许多技术领域用户所普遍使用精准图像处理工具,它可以从图像中检测出人脸,并以多种方式分析出特征以及其他识别信息。...人脸检测API被广泛应用于智能社交网络分析、自动身份认证和安全系统等多种行业。它工作原理是,把图像数据输入到深度神经网络中,通过特定处理过程来提取出图像中的人脸特征信息,如人脸位置、脸型和表情等。...通过这些过程可以实现脸部特征检测、特征抽取以及自动识别等功能。未来,随着技术发展,人脸检测API应用范围将进一步扩大,将会给人们生活带来更多便利,并为应用开发者提供更多智能图像处理工具。...APISpace 人脸检测API 上线辣!快速检测图片中的人脸并返回人脸位置,输出脸颊、眉、眼、口、鼻关键点坐标,支持识别多张人脸。

    72120

    网页视频autoplay兼容及解决方案

    各个浏览器对视频自动播放限制 IOS IOS9以下版本: 无法自动播放 (在当时移动互联网条件下,播放一个视频流量和电量成本都是非常高,因此视频播放必须要先经过用户同意) IOS10以上版本:...检测自动播放,播放失败时回退到用户交互触发播放 通过play API返回Promise检测自动播放成功还是失败 不使用autoplay属性,而是调用play API来尝试进行自动播放,高版本浏览器会返回一个...Promise,如果自动播放失败,则Promise会拒绝(低版本浏览器不会返回Promise,此时可以通过事件或参数来检测自动播放) var promise = document.querySelector...,通过超时判断自动播放失败 使用autoplay属性,或调用play API来尝试进行自动播放,通过监听由自动播放触发play事件,监听timeupdate事件,查看currentTime是否发生了变化等等办法来检测自动播放成功...增加网站视频受众,解除自动播放限制 浏览器限制策略不是绝对,如果在本地尝试将你网页代理到知名视频网站(比如youtube.com),会发现自动播放限制被解除了。

    12710

    api网关监控功能 api网关重要性

    随着企业级应用系统复杂化以及多重系统交互性,api网关在实际应用当中越来越广泛,api网关基本功能多种多样,包括监控预警功能,路由分发功能,安全策略调用链追踪等等不同使用功能。...下面来谈一谈api网关监控功能。...api网关监控功能 监控和预警功能api网关重要功能之一,api网关监控功能主要职责是及时发现网关以及后端服务器连接异常,在api监控平台上面用户可以随时查看日志信息,监控信息,调用链等等,并且主机发生任何异常都会自动报警到控制台...api网关重要性 上述提到api网关监控功能只是api网关众多功能当中其中一个。...而且随着api系统不断延伸和发展,日后功能会比现在更加全面和专业,对企业应用系统带来更多便利。 以上就是api网关监控功能相关内容。

    2.7K30

    通过Jenkins API获得检测JenkinsVersion

    关于获得/检测JenkinsVersion,下面页面(Jenkins Remote access API)中有说明: https://wiki.jenkins-ci.org/display/JENKINS.../Remote+access+API Detecting Jenkins version(检测JenkinsVersion) To check the version of Jenkins, load...使用浏览器为Chrome,在Chrome中查看response header方法如下: 1、按F12,弹出对话框,按Network选项; 2、点击网址/jenkins/api/python,然后点击Header...使用Python获取Jenkins Versionexample如下: import requests jenkins_python_api_url = "http://localhost:8080...') 运行结果如下: 1.592 注意:获取JenkinsVersion无需考虑认证情况(无论是否需要认证,都可以获得JenkinsVersion) 同时,通过查阅Jenkins相关源码,可以得知

    1.7K50

    误码检测单元功能设计

    本章具体介绍误码率测试仪基本功能设计方法以及各部分具体电路设计。主要包括 FPGA 内部码型发生单元,误码插入单元、误码检测单元,同步单元,误码计数单元,模拟信道单元和显示单元组成。...3.1基本功能设计 本节将介绍各个功能模块功能和实现核心代码等。 3.1.1伪随机码型发生单元设计 码型发生单元主要描述是伪随机序列产生模块,伪随机序列产生有两种方式:串行和并行。...同步信号提取及状态检测是误码统计前提,该部分将在接下来进行介绍。误码统计模块统计误码个数。本节主要设计误码检测单元各部分逻辑模块。下面是本模块核心代码。...St1功能是比对本地和接收到码,对其进行计数,用于st2判断误码个数,st3是本地码和接收码未同步,对本地码进行暂停一个周期,加快对同步检测。...,其主要功能是模仿实际信道,对传输码中加入一定误码,然后将生成序列发送给接收部分。

    49230

    如何关闭常见浏览器 HSTS 功能

    它告诉浏览器只能通过HTTPS访问,而绝对禁止HTTP方式。...但是,在日常开发过程中,有时我们会想测试页面在 HTTP 连接中表现情况,这时 HSTS 存在会让调试不能方便进行下去。...而且由于 HSTS 并不是像 cookie 一样存放在浏览器缓存里,简单清空浏览器缓存操作并没有什么效果,页面依然通过 HTTPS 方式传输。...那么怎样才能关闭浏览器 HSTS 呢,各种谷歌~~度娘~~之后,在这里汇总一下几大常见浏览器 HSTS 关闭方法。...和 Chrome 方法一样 Firefox 浏览器 关闭所有已打开页面 清空历史记录和缓存 地址栏输入about:permissions 搜索项目域名,并点击 Forget About This Site

    3.5K30

    人脸跟踪:基于人脸检测 API 连续检测与姿态估计技术

    通过连续的人脸检测与姿态估计,可以实现对人脸在视频序列中跟踪和姿态分析。本文将介绍基于人脸检测API的人脸跟踪技术,探讨其原理、应用场景以及未来发展前景。...人脸跟踪意义和挑战人脸跟踪技术目标是在连续视频序列中准确地检测和跟踪人脸,同时估计人脸姿态和位置。...人脸跟踪技术原理人脸跟踪技术通常基于以下步骤实现:图片初始化:在视频序列第一帧中,利用人脸检测API定位和标定人脸,获取初始的人脸位置和姿态信息。...连续检测:随后,在后续视频帧中,使用人脸检测API对人脸进行连续检测,更新人脸位置和姿态信息。姿态估计:通过分析人脸检测结果,结合姿态估计算法,可以估计人脸姿态,如头部旋转、倾斜和俯仰等。...结论基于人脸检测 API 的人脸跟踪技术在视频监控、虚拟现实和人机交互等领域具有广泛应用。通过连续的人脸检测与姿态估计,可以实现对人脸跟踪和姿态分析。

    33200

    【Go API 开发实战 1】该教程所实现 API 功能

    本教程所实现 API 功能 本教程通过实现一个账号系统,来演示如何构建一个真实 API 服务器,构建方法和技术是我根据之前服务器开发经验不断优化沉淀而成。...管理 API 源码 如何给 API 命令添加版本功能 如何管理 API 命令 如何生成 Swagger 在线文档 测试阶段 如何进行单元测试 如何进行性能测试(函数性能) 如何做性能分析 API 性能测试和调优...部署阶段 如何用 Nginx 部署 API 服务 如何做 API 高可用 通过以上各功能介绍,读者可以完整、系统地学习 API 构建方法和技巧,笔者也会在文章中融入自己开发经验以供读者参考。...账号系统业务功能 本教程为了演示,构建了一个测试账号系统(后面统称为apiserver),功能如下: API 服务器状态检查 登录测试账号 新增测试账号 删除测试账号 更新测试账号 获取测试账号信息...小结 本小节介绍了教程所要实现 API 功能,以及 API 系统业务功能,让读者在实战前对教程所要构建系统有个整体了解,以便于接下来学习。教程每一节都会提供源码,供读者学习参考。

    1.4K31

    BruteLoops:协议无关在线密码安全检测API

    关于BruteLoops BruteLoops是一款功能强大且协议无关在线密码安全检测API,广大研究人员可以使用BruteLoops来实现在线密码猜解,以检查用户所使用密码是否安全,或识别密码中安全问题...BruteLoops针对身份验证接口提供了密码爆破猜解功能,代码库中提供了一个模块化使用示例,并演示了如何使用BruteLoops来实现密码安全解析。...它功能非常齐全,并且提供了多个爆破模块,下面给出是其功能示例: · http.accellion_ftp FTP HTTP接口登录加速模块 · http.basic_digest 通用HTTP...http.mattermost Mattermost登录Web接口 · http.netwrix Netwrix登录Web接口 · http.okta Okta JSON API...工具要求Python 3.7或更高版本Python环境,以及SQLAlchemy 1.3.0,后者可以通过pip工具以及该项目提供requirements.txt来安装: python3.7 -m

    1.1K30

    使用Pluto 检测已弃用 Kubernetes API

    前言 Kubernetes版本不断迭代中,Kubernetes API 也一直在变化。随着这些更改出现,API 某些部分被弃用并最终被删除。...我们如何发现已弃用和即将删除API版本资源呢?该问题一个答案是查看官方弃用文档,并检查在即将到来Kubernetes更新中将删除API资源版本。...幸运是,FairwindOps pluto等工具可帮助我们发现已弃用和即将删除资源 API 版本。...Kubernetes API弃用原因 Kubernetes指定了一个弃用策略,它定义了如果API某些部分被弃用意味着什么?...本质上意味着Kubernetes API服务器相关端点被标记为删除并最后被删除,由于API服务器管理资源生命周期,因此使用已删除API版本资源将组织该资源部署。

    25130

    chrome 66自动播放策略调整

    [ba44d518-eb46-4ce8-8a65-6abae68a8840] 背景 Web浏览器正在朝着更严格自动播放策略发展,以便改善用户体验,最大限度地降低安装广告拦截器积极性并减少昂贵和/或受限网络上数据消耗...用户MEI位于chrome://media-engagement/内部页面 [media-engagement] 开发者开关 作为开发者,您可能需要在本地更改Chrome浏览器自动播放政策行为,以根据用户参与情况测试您网站...PreloadMediaEngagementData,AutoplayIgnoreWebAudio, MediaEngagementBypassAutoplayPolicies Iframe 委托授权 一个功能政策使开发人员可以选择性地启用和禁用各种浏览器功能和...一旦来源获得了自动播放权限,它就可以将该权限委托给具有自动播放功能跨源iframe 。默认情况下,同源iframe可以使用自动播放。 当禁用自动播放功能策略时

    5K20

    Js自动播放HTML音乐(不受浏览器限制,无需先与浏览器交互,无需对浏览器进行修改)

    众所周知,声音无法自动播放一直是IOS/Android上惯例。桌面版Safari也在2017年第11版宣布禁止带声音多媒体自动播放功能。...随后2018年4月发布Chrome 66正式关闭了声音自动播放,这意味着音频自动播放和视频自动播放在桌面浏览器中也会失效。...当前谷歌浏览器已经删除了自动播放策略选项,所以当你进入谷歌浏览器进行设置时,是找不到这个选项。而且作为网页背景音乐,你还要把效果展示给别人看。所以,改变浏览器选项还不够成熟。先说第二种方法。...然后有人问,既然谷歌Chrome背景音乐不能自动播放,究竟怎么解决呢? 这里使用Audio APIAudioContext来自于我搭建一个播放器。...; } 构建播放器后,可以在进入页面时缓存,然后自动播放背景音乐,不考虑浏览器。 注意事项 这种方法只对浏览器有效,无法实现APP上自动播放音乐效果。

    5.7K80

    浏览器姿态检测:PoseNet 模型(附代码)

    PoseNet 独立模型,一些 Demo,可在浏览器上使用 TensorFlow.js 实时运行人体姿态检测。...PoseNet 可以用于检测单个或多个姿势,意味着有一个版本算法可以检测一幅图像或视频中单个人,而另一个版本算法可以检测视频或图像中多个人。...npm install @tensorflow-models/posenet 使用 我们多姿势检测可以从一副图像中检测出每个姿势。每种方法都有自己算法和参数集。...拥有超强 GPU 计算机建议采用该值。如果计算机拥有中等或低端 GPU,建议乘数采用0.75。移动设备建议使用0.5。 单人姿势检测 单人姿势检测是两种算法中最简单也是运行最快。...多重姿势检测 多重姿态检测可以解码图像中多个姿势。比单个姿势检测算法复杂得多,并且运行速度稍慢,但却在图像中有多人情况下很有优势,检测关键点不太可能与错误姿势相关联。

    3K41

    内置于浏览器国际化API

    现在这可能已经不是最好方法了,因为我们有 ECMAScript 国际化 API。 国际化 API 旨在提供许多应用所需语言敏感功能。它可以帮助你完成需要考虑语言任务。...浏览器将所有上述功能保留在 Intl 全局对象中,以避免发生命名冲突。...通过从头编写新库,他能够改变一些重要事情。最重要是 Luxon 使用了国际化 API。多亏了这一点,它不必像Moment 那样发布国际化文件。 我们还需要考虑浏览器支持。...Sine Luxon 专注于使用原生 API,但并非每个浏览器都能完整支持。如果你对此担心的话,也可以考虑使用 polyfill。...国际化 API 其他很酷功能 ECMAScript Internationalization API提供了其他有用功能。其中之一是格式化列表能力。

    1.4K20

    api网关路由怎么做 api网关其他功能有什么?

    因此api网关就显得尤为重要。 api拥有路由转发功能api网关路由怎么做呢? api网关路由怎么做? api网关路由怎么做?这个问题是一个重要问题。...在api网关控制台添加新api分组,然后选择添加新路由,路由参数可以自定义设置,但是在设置时候要注意不同访问路径对于自定义路由参数限制。 api网关其他功能有什么?...上面已经解决了api网关路由怎么做,路由转发只是api网关其中一个核心功能api网关还有其他许多明显功能优势。...这些优势包括安全功能,限流功能,日志记录功能,熔断功能以及降级处理等等,它核心关键点就是用户通过统一api关口来访问后台服务端所有微服务。这种访问方式更加便于后端服务器监控以及流量均衡。...以上就是api网关路由怎么做相关内容。不只是api网关路由转发,api网关任何功能都有它注意事项以及它具体参数配置,在具体管理过程当中要根据不同应用需要来考虑。

    87720
    领券